Mark Fraser is a Visiting Fellow in the Department of Health Economics Wellbeing and Society at the Australian National University's National Centre for Epidemiology and Population Health (NCEPH). His role involves interdisciplinary research focused on public health and societal wellbeing.
Education background includes:
- Bachelor of Arts in Computing (CCAE)
- Master of Financial Management (MFM)
- Bachelor of Science in Psychology (Honours, ANU)
Research interests center on health economics, population health dynamics, wellbeing frameworks, social determinants of health, and epidemiological methods. These align with NCEPH's mission to address complex public health challenges through policy-relevant research.
